Transaction

5159031742823aa46f19edd9cd5d70dcce36c9ed9a3fbb49963ac933d315a3be

Summary

In Block325157
TimeWed, 23 Aug 2023 18:53:00 UTC
Total Input2181.96243972 Nebula
Total Output2181.96237612 Nebula
Fees0.0000636 Nebula

Details

Fee: 0.0000636 Nebula
633047 Confirmations2181.96237612 Nebula
Raw Transaction